Residents of RAK battle fly menace

RAS AL KHAIMAH — Residents and visitors in Ras Al Khaimah have a new nuisance in the form of flies.

Flies have infested some residential areas and public places in the emirate, posing health hazards to people.

“Flies are everywhere. As we know, flies spread many dangerous diseases, some of which are life-threatening if not treated in the early stages,” said a Twalib A., a resident of Nakheel.

Some residents attributed the spread of flies in various parts of Ras Al Khaimah to the changes in the temperatures. The low temperature levels being experienced these days are favourable for their breeding and spreading.

Adnan Regal, an Egyptian expatriate living in Khuzam, flies are seen in some residential areas these days, especially around garbage bins. Some of them enter the houses. “Earlier, you could hardly see any flies around. I have started seeing flies around the place after the change in the temperatures. They are a threat to our lives as they can move from the dirty places to the houses, and reach uncovered foods and kitchen utensils,” added Regal.

One visitor who was recently in a public park in Ras Al Khaimah also complained about the flies. The flies have become a nuisance, spoiling their leisure time.

Commenting on the menace of flies in the emirate, an official from the Environment and Health Department at RAK Municipality, who did not want to be named, said that they are aware of the problem but it is not very serious.
